    hi,just hold your finger on the food and a pop up will appear to delete it,hope this helps? I am new to this still learning

    ^^This I believe is just for the Android app. I think I've seen other users say that for the iOS (Apple) app, you swipe left on the food? And on the website, click the red circle with the white horizontal bar that's to the right of the food you want to get rid ot.
